WebIn the early 1880s, phosphate was discovered several miles up the Peace River, which empties into Charlotte Harbor before flowing west through the Boca Grande Channel to the Gulf of Mexico. Initially, the phosphate was shipped down the Peace River on barges to Port Boca Grande on Gasparilla Island, where it was loaded into ocean-going vessels. In 1958 Florida Power & Light built a berth for ships at the port and a storage facility for incoming oil. The oil was then barged to the power plant in Fort Myers.
